Based on the award-winning two-woman play by Amy Nostbakken and Norah Sadava, Patricia Rozema has adapted Mouthpiece about an aspiring writer attempting to reconcile her feminism with the conformist choices of her mother following her mother’s sudden death. Cassandra, who is portrayed by the two women (Nostbakken and Sadava), expresses the opposing voices that exist inside the modern woman’s head, during a 48-hour period as she tries to organize the affairs for her mother’s funeral. Rozema was attracted to the story after seeing a performance of the play at Toronto’s Nightwood Theatre. |
